General annotation (Comments)

Function

Destroys radicals which are normally produced within the cells and which are toxic to biological systems By similarity. RuleBase RU000414

Catalytic activity

2 superoxide + 2 H+ = O2 + H2O2. RuleBase RU000414

Sequence similarities

Belongs to the iron/manganese superoxide dismutase family. RuleBase RU004477
